Fofana happy with 'aggressive' Milan performance in Bologna: "We're all united"
"I felt pretty good tactically tonight. It was a tough match against a team that plays man-to-man. We had to be a bit aggressive and play with maturity. Personally, I felt good, even physically. But I can always do better with the ball."
"It's not just the four of us, it's the whole team together. It's always nice to give a hug to those who did well, like Adri [Rabiot] tonight or Nkunku, who started slowly but is now a top-level player. We're all united, don't worry (laughs)."
"Honestly? The goal is to do better than last year."
Youssouf Fofana returned to the starting line-up after two matches on the bench and delivered a tactically sound, physically strong performance against Bologna. AC Milan won 3-0 with goals from Ruben Loftus-Cheek, Christopher Nkunku and Adrien Rabiot, extending their Serie A unbeaten run to 22 games. The result moved Milan five points behind Inter and seven clear of Roma in fifth. Fofana emphasized the need for aggression combined with maturity, praised unity among teammates—highlighting the French players—and set a collective objective to improve on last season's achievements. Several players returned to form and contributed to a confident team display.
